What Information Should I Have On An ID Bracelet?
A MyEpilepsyTeam Member asked a question 💭

I'm thinking about getting an ID bracelet. The ones I've seen just say epilepsy. Is that enough? What do other people have put on their bracelets? I'm not sure about putting my meds on it because I don't want to have to keep changing the bracelet if my meds change.

I have one.. It reads:
Penecillin
PDA '83
Craniotomy '03

Pda is an open heart surgery I had at 9 months old (important to know about if Im unable to communicate with medical professionals)
My neurologist suggested I put 'craniotomy' rather than the more accurate 'right temporal lobectomy' because he said 'everyone knows what the cranium is, not everyone will recognize lobectomy as a brain surgery... Once they see your scar they will be able to figure out what happened'

Its not glamorous but I have a custom designed gold,whitegold, and silver bracelet that I have only removed for MRIs and surgery for the past 18 years.

If you have metal implants (VNS) adding a line like this might help:

Embedded metal
Or
VNS implant

Hope this helps a bit.
